Transaction 7917438afcfd8e23e89257af2f18f13460356c3fbc8496f0507ad4ceca3e5684
1 Input
1 Output
-
7917438afcfd8e23e89257af2f18f13460356c3fbc8496f0507ad4ceca3e5684:0
- value
- 2081785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f99c677ab04818cd0430447f2eb7808466fe7505 OP_EQUAL
- address
- 3QSqYTvNaHAvoqWXjz81NiTmtLh64HK7Du